About This Trial
Knee osteoarthritis (KOA) is a prevalent degenerative joint disease characterized by pain, stiffness, and reduced physical function, significantly impacting quality of life especially in elderly population.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ria:
* Age ≥ 45 and ≤ 65
* Both Male and Female
* Knee Pain persisting for at-least 3 months
* Pain severity during walking ≥ 2/10 on a Numeric Pain Rating Scale
* Walking and Balance (Mobility) problems according to Time Up \& Go (TUG) test
